Caterpillar is proud to partner with NC State to present a program that honors the achievements of our student-athletes in the classrooms as well as on the playing fields. Each month two Wolfpack Scholar athletes will be selected as a member of the Caterpillar Scholar Athlete team. To be named to the Caterpillar Scholar Athlete team, a student-athlete must maintain a 3.00 GPA for at least one semester and be a full-time student at NC State.
During the Spring 2003 semester 210 Wolfpack Student Athletes achieved a semester GPA of 3.00 or higher and 107 student-athletes were Dean's List honorees.
This month Caterpillar and NC State are proud to honor cross country's Jessica Durant and football's William Lee.
Jessica Durant returns to the NC State women's cross country team after redshirting her freshman year. The Hendersonville, North Carolina native achieved a 4.00 Total Grade Point Average her first year on campus. The Biological Sciences major also made the NC State Dean's List both semesters and was also named to the ACC Honor Roll.
William Lee handles the long-snapping duties on the NC State football team. The sophomore from Fuquay-Varina is also right on target in the classroom. William posted a 4.00 Total Grade Point Average his freshman year at State while majoring in Mechanical Engineering. William was also a member of the ACC Honor Roll and made the Dean's List both semesters at NC State.
